in available time

Grammar usage guide and real-world examples

USAGE SUMMARY

The phrase "in available time" is grammatically correct and can be used in written English.
It is typically used to describe something that can be done or completed within a certain amount of time that is currently or soon to be available. Example: "I will try to finish the project in available time before the deadline." This means that the speaker will make an effort to complete the project within the timeframe that is currently available or will become available before the deadline. Another example: "Please schedule your appointments in available time slots throughout the day." This means that the speaker is asking the person to choose appointment times that are currently or soon to be available throughout the day.

Expert writing Tips

Best practice

When using "in available time", ensure that the context clearly defines what timeframe you are referring to. If the available time is ambiguous, clarify it to avoid confusion.

Common error

Avoid assuming that the reader knows what the "available time" refers to. Always provide context. For example, instead of saying, "Complete the task in available time", specify, "Complete the task in available time this afternoon".

FAQs

How can I use "in available time" in a sentence?

You can use "in available time" to indicate that something should be done within a specific period. For example, "The questionnaire was completed "in the available time" by 148 panel members".

What is a good alternative to "in available time"?

Alternatives include phrases like "within the given timeframe", "subject to time constraints", or "given the time available" depending on the nuance you want to convey.

Is it better to say "in the available time" or "in available time"?

Both phrases are grammatically correct, but ""in the available time"" is generally more common and natural-sounding. The inclusion of "the" often provides better clarity and flow.

What does "in available time" mean?

The phrase "in available time" means that an action or process must be completed within the period that is currently free or soon to be free, but is likely limited. The meaning is generally the same as "in the time available".
